在Ubuntu 12.04上安装MySQL和mysqlnd的步骤

在Ubuntu 12.04上安装MySQL和mysqlnd的步骤

在本文中,我们将介绍如何在Ubuntu 12.04上同时安装MySQL和mysqlnd。MySQL是一个流行的关系型数据库管理系统,而mysqlnd是一个PHP扩展,可以使PHP更好地与MySQL交互。

阅读更多:MySQL 教程

步骤一:安装MySQL

首先,我们需要安装MySQL。我们可以使用下面的命令来安装MySQL:

sudo apt-get install mysql-server
Mysql

安装过程中,我们将被要求设置MySQL root用户的密码。这是一个重要的安全配置,我们需要确保密码强度高且不易被猜测。

安装完成后,我们需要启动MySQL服务。我们可以使用以下命令:

sudo service mysql start
Mysql

如果一切正常,我们应该能够通过以下命令登录MySQL:

mysql -u root -p
Mysql

我们将被要求输入刚才设置的密码。如果我们成功登录,我们应该可以看到一个MySQL提示符。

步骤二:安装mysqlnd

接下来,我们将安装mysqlnd。我们可以使用下面的命令安装:

sudo apt-get install php5-mysqlnd
Mysql

这个命令会同时安装mysqlnd和PHP的MySQL扩展。

安装完成后,我们需要重新启动Apache服务:

sudo service apache2 restart
Mysql

现在,我们可以使用PHP来访问我们之前安装的MySQL数据库。下面是一个简单的示例程序:

<?php
servername = "localhost";username = "root";
password = "your_password";dbname = "your_database";

//连接到MySQL服务器
conn = mysqli_connect(servername, username,password, dbname);

//检查连接是否成功
if (!conn) {
    die("连接失败: " . mysqli_connect_error());
}

//执行一条SQL语句
sql = "SELECT * FROM your_table";result = mysqli_query(conn,sql);

//处理SQL执行结果
if (mysqli_num_rows(result)>0) {
    while(row = mysqli_fetch_assoc(result)) {
        echo "ID: " .row["id"]. " - Name: " . row["name"]. "<br>";
    }
} else {
    echo "没有找到任何记录。";
}

//关闭连接
mysqli_close(conn);
?>
PHP

在上面的示例中,我们连接到我们之前安装的MySQL数据库,并执行一条SELECT查询。如果查询返回任何结果,我们将输出这些结果。

总结

在本文中,我们介绍了在Ubuntu 12.04上同时安装MySQL和mysqlnd的步骤。通过安装MySQL和mysqlnd,我们可以使用PHP更好地与MySQL交互,并开发强大的Web应用程序。

Python教程

Java教程

Web教程

数据库教程

图形图像教程

大数据教程

开发工具教程

计算机教程

登录

注册